This work of thesis is based on the research program Optimum of Aviation Customer Process backed up by the Engineering of Aviation Transfer Convenience, which is financial supported by National Aviation Fund. The research consists mainly of two parts: 1) Boarding process(arrival and departure process), 2) Luggage transfer and claiming process. The paper introduces firstly the current situation of domestic and international aviation transfer market and presents the significances and necessity of performing researches in Convenience Engineering Project in our country. Secondly, problems existed in passenger check-in and security-check procedures are analyzed in the paper. By using the queue theory, researches on optimizing these two queuing system are performed based on the actual duty data gathered from Lu-kou airport and suggestions of some optimum models are given consequently. The luggage processing system's functions and its subsystem are described then and some disadvantages are also pointed out, to eliminate the disadvantages a sequence number naming method in luggage arrival process is put forward. In addition the paper designs three models for boarding optimum scheduling, in which network graph algorithm and grid algorithm are derived. The two algorithms are programmed into the boarding schedule applications at Lu-Kou airport and some computation results in this practical application are provided. Finally the author makes conclusions and prospects on the processes in future waiting building and gives some reasonable suggestions.
